Output d33c617086b7bea50efcd5d55f8d9ada95b7a62bbf002d0db5d422f9b0902fe2:1

value
11689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c07a0cd72928296ed273ef2bc3abd1fff9054c1 OP_EQUAL
address
37ARc4mD3vLwf5yrodkU1FssdTuaBXa3ig
transaction
d33c617086b7bea50efcd5d55f8d9ada95b7a62bbf002d0db5d422f9b0902fe2